Swift wins top prize at AMAs, says she's re-recording music

Read full article: Swift wins top prize at AMAs, says she's re-recording music

In this screen shot provided by ABC on Sunday, Nov. 22, 2020, Taylor Swift accepts the award for artist of the year at the American Music Awards at the Microsoft Theater in Los Angeles. (ABC via AP)NEW YORK – Taylor Swift won her third consecutive artist of the year prize at the American Music Awards, but she missed the show for a good reason: She said she's busy re-recording her early music after her catalog was sold. She also won favorite music video and favorite pop/rock female artist, winning three honors and tying Bieber, Dan + Shay and the Weeknd for most wins Sunday. Breakthrough singer-rapper Doja Cat performed and won new artist of the year and favorite soul/R&B female artist. And Megan Thee Stallion — won favorite rap/hip-hop songs for “WAP" with Cardi B — performed “Body" from her recently released debut album “Good News."

Man rallies giant herd of cows with just a saxophone in hilarious video

Read full article: Man rallies giant herd of cows with just a saxophone in hilarious video

Who knew a few jazzy lines from a saxophone could draw an entire herd of cows together so quickly? Rick Herrmann may have started playing the saxophone just seven months ago, but that didn't stop him from practicing in front of a crowd. I started playing the sax 7 months ago. He posted a video of himself on Instagram playing a saxophone next to a cow farm in Lafayette, Oregon. At the beginning of the video, Hermann says he's heard music can tame big animals, so he put the theory to test.
